Hey all, just need a bit of help with some animating. I want to achieve an effect where if you had a Flash navigational menu and you rollover a button, a shadow slides behind it. Then if I was to roll over a button on the other end of the menu, that shadow would slide (from where it was previously from) and go behind the other button which I just rolled over...how is this achieved? I'm guessing you have a movie clip and few invisible buttons but have no idea what needs to be done!! Any help?? :roll:

you would need to have the shadow as a seperate movieclip. When you roll over any button you would then need to trigger a function that took the current _x of the mouse or similar and tween the shadow to that position. Something along those lines anyway
